A subtype of the dental ceramic furnace, this unit is optimized for firing dental porcelains (feldspathic ceramics) used for veneering metal substructures or creating all-porcelain restorations. Operating around 800°C, it controls the vitrification process meticulously. The working principle involves programmable vacuum firing cycles that remove air bubbles and ensure optimal bonding and aesthetics. Its purpose is to create the lifelike layers of color and translucency that characterize high-quality dental crowns and bridges. It is essential for achieving the natural appearance demanded in cosmetic dentistry.

A muffle furnace is usually the first furnace a lab installs, since it covers the broadest share of everyday heating, drying and ashing tasks before more specialised equipment is added.
A muffle furnace isolates the sample from direct contact with heating elements or combustion gases, giving cleaner, more repeatable results than an open flame or hot-plate process.
